A Romantic Day in Milton Keynes

  • Start your day with a delectable breakfast at The Greedy Italian, serving fresh coffee and homemade pastries.
  • Explore the beautiful gardens and impressive sculptures at the MK Rose, a tranquil space in the heart of the city.
  • Take a stroll around the picturesque Willen Lake, admiring the swans and ducks, and indulge in a picnic with delicious treats from Fenny Kitchen.
  • Unwind with a couples’ spa treatment at the opulent Abbey Hill Hotel, boasting a hot tub, sauna and steam room.
  • Enjoy an intimate dinner at The Birch, a charming gastropub with a warm ambiance and a varied menu of classic British cuisine.
  • End your magical day with a show at MK Theatre, hosting a range of productions from musicals to stand-up comedy.

How to get there

Plane

The best way to get to Milton Keynes by plane is to fly into London Heathrow Airport (LHR) and then take a direct train from Heathrow Airport to Milton Keynes Central Station.

Car

Driving is a popular option to get to Milton Keynes. You can take the M1 motorway and exit at junction 14 for Milton Keynes. The journey time will vary depending on the starting location and traffic conditions.

Train

To reach Milton Keynes by train, you can take a direct train from London Euston Station to Milton Keynes Central Station. The journey takes approximately 35 minutes.

Boat

Since Milton Keynes is an inland city, there are no direct boat routes available.

Bus

Traveling to Milton Keynes by bus is convenient and affordable. You can take a direct bus from London Victoria Coach Station to Milton Keynes Coachway. The journey usually takes around 2 hours.
